在使用Clash进行网络配置时,合理地组织配置文件结构和添加必要的注释是提升配置质量的重要步骤。一个整洁的Clash配置不仅便于维护,还能提高效率。本文将介绍一些优化Clash配置的方法,帮助你构建一个既美观又高效的网络配置。
首先,我们来谈谈Clash配置的基本结构。一个基本的Clash配置文件通常包含几个部分,如代理设置、路由规则、策略配置等。通过合理的划分,可以使得配置文件更加清晰。
代理设置部分是配置文件中的核心,用于定义如何处理网络请求。例如,你可以为不同的网络服务设置不同的代理。在Clash中,通常使用JSON或YAML格式来描述代理设置。
路由规则用于定义哪些流量应该被路由到特定的代理。通过使用正则表达式等技术,可以实现复杂的路由规则,确保流量能够正确地被引导到正确的代理上。
策略配置部分用于定义流量的优先级、流量类型等。例如,你可以定义哪些流量应该被优先处理,哪些流量应该被限制等。
在配置文件中添加注释可以帮助你和他人更好地理解配置的目的和作用。注释应该简洁明了,尽量避免冗长的描述。
对于代理设置部分,可以添加注释来说明每个代理的作用。例如,对于HTTP代理,可以说明其主要功能,以及是否支持HTTPS等。
对于路由规则部分,可以添加注释来说明每个规则的作用。例如,对于特定的URL或域名,可以说明其应该被路由到哪个代理。
对于策略配置部分,可以添加注释来说明每个策略的作用。例如,对于流量优先级的设置,可以说明其目的是什么。
除了手动优化,还有一些工具可以帮助你更好地组织和优化Clash配置文件。例如,Clash提供了CLI工具,可以用于生成和修改配置文件。此外,还有一些第三方工具可以提供更高级的功能,如自动优化配置文件、生成文档等。
通过合理地组织配置文件结构和添加必要的注释,可以使Clash配置更加整洁、高效。希望本文提供的方法能帮助你构建一个既美观又高效的网络配置。在配置过程中,不要忘记根据自己的需求进行适当的调整,以达到最佳效果。